Stigma7, when doing pull-offs you don't have to play tap/hammer-on
or pluck with the finger as you said,
you just have to perform pull-off.
BUT you need to place finger for next note BEFORE you perform pull-off,
that's the deal. ![]()

Hello folks and welcome to Legato and Picking lesson on Intermediate level!
In this very lesson we'll try to improve our both Legato and Alternate Picking by simply playing the same thing twice but using these 2 techniques. This approach is also a fine test to notice types of licks that cause you more problems one way or another so you could focus more and fix those errors.
The lesson is in a key of Em and we'll be using straight natural E Minor scale, tempo is 100 bpm, 4/4 bar.
